Output 315d70341e1df1b1a6f14daf0d9f6c6b2e804cf77f9cef5993420460024296aa:0

value
379484755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 909129897577284a0dd7ffbc697601a9b0dcafc0 OP_EQUAL
address
3EsR8Da4ii4iZwYwDb3DK9cjKrcer1sS2n
transaction
315d70341e1df1b1a6f14daf0d9f6c6b2e804cf77f9cef5993420460024296aa
spent
true